Forward Ryan Russell, who made his NHL debut last season and ended up playing 41 games with the Blue Jackets, signed a one-year, two-way contract to return with the club in 2012-13. He'll earn $700,000 at the NHL level and $105,000 in the AHL.

Russell rounds out Canada roster
Defenceman Kris Russell of the St. Louis Blues will complete Canada's 23-man roster at the world hockey championship.
